1 definition by UNICORNS 567

Top Definition
A total crackhead, but also very nice, knows how to make people laugh and lots of girls have had a crush on him at some point. He is an amazing person to talk to and takes time to help you. Like to play Hockey, Soccer, and the Trumpet. Has an ex who still likes him
Band teacher: Griffin SHUT UP
Rest of the class: not again (rolls eyes)
Griffin: (Chucks pencil at friend)
Band teacher: sighs...
by UNICORNS 567 November 29, 2019

Mug icon
Buy a Griffin mug!